Quick Facts for Pilots

Quick Facts for Pilots

Quick Facts for Pilots

Site type:

Site type:

NW facing ridge and thermal flying over plains.

Flying style:

Flying style:

Soaring, thermal flights, potential for small triangles (20km)

Main season:

Main season:

October to May. Can extend a month earlier and later based on weather.

Typical day

Typical day

Thermals start around noon, highest thermals around 3-5pm, while evenings often smoother and soarable until sunset.

Takeoff altitude:

Takeoff altitude:

Around 1,250 m ASL.

Landing altitude

Landing altitude

Around 800 m.

TakeOff Access and Conditions

Reaching Take off:

Reaching Take off:

From Maison Faisal, it takes about 20 minutes car drive to reach take off parking. Then, either you hike for 20 min to reach take off point or continue by car if you have a 4x4. Check parking fees at that point if applicable.

Launch area
Launch area

Takeoff is on a rocky ridge overlooking the plains and the Lalla Takerkoust Lake, with 2 key launch areas which are cleared for take off. The ground is uneven and stony, so good shoes and careful wing preparation are essential. On good days you will find smooth cycles and clear airflow; on stronger days, expect more active piloting, especially in spring and midday hours.

Landing:

Landing Zones on the Plains

Landing Zones on the Plains

Highly recommend visiting the landing area and getting familiar with its location and surrounding before the first flight. Landing areas on the plains have two spots at the foot of the ridge below Aguergour. Pilots mostly use these open fields, which are marked, but with some small rocks, slight slopes, and farm areas. Advanced pilots can choose to top land at the take off when conditions allow. Avoid landing where there are crops.

Weather and Seaesonality

How The site evolve throughout the year :

Maison Faisal
Maison Faisal

October to Nov:

October to Nov:

Start of the season for solo pilots, autumn conditions, usually strong wind take off and decent thermals.

December to Jan :

December to Jan :

Milder conditions at take off, good thermals in afternoon and soaring before sunset

Feb–April

Feb–April

Stronger thermals and more dynamic air; great for experienced pilots, more demanding for beginners.

Summer:

Summer:

Often too windy and turbulent in the heat of the day; most pilots avoid midsummer except for very early or late flights with local guidance.
